What Exactly is Emotion AI?

Think of emotion AI as giving machines the ability to understand and respond to human emotions. Imagine your phone or a chatbot sensing when you’re upset or stressed. Instead of delivering a generic factual response, it offers something more compassionate or supportive. By analyzing voice tones, facial expressions, and text, emotion AI identifies the emotions behind the words, making interactions feel more human and meaningful.

For instance, a virtual assistant could detect frustration in your tone after a long day and respond with calming suggestions or uplifting words. This capability transforms tech into a supportive companion, rather than just a functional tool.

Meet “Name Your Feelings” Therapy

Ever struggled to pinpoint your emotions? “Name Your Feelings” therapy is designed to help. Using large language models, this technique aids individuals in identifying and verbalizing their emotions.

Picture this: You’re chatting with a virtual assistant about your day. It picks up on your frustration and gently prompts you to label your feelings. This exercise, while simple, can provide clarity and relief. The integration of emotion AI in such therapeutic approaches highlights its potential to make emotional well-being more accessible.

Real Talk on Challenges

Emotion AI faces significant hurdles as it develops. The complexities of human emotions, such as sarcasm or cultural nuances, present ongoing challenges. Here are key areas of concern:

AI Biases: Machines learn from data, and biased data can lead to flawed emotional interpretations. Addressing these biases is critical to building reliable systems.

Emotion Misinterpretation: Misjudging an emotion can lead to misunderstandings, potentially exacerbating the situation rather than resolving it. For instance, interpreting frustration as anger could result in unhelpful or inappropriate responses, underscoring the need for nuanced emotional comprehension.

While these challenges are significant, they also highlight opportunities for continuous improvement in the field. Ongoing collaboration between technologists, psychologists, and ethicists will be crucial in overcoming these hurdles and realizing the full potential of emotion AI.

Real-World Example: Woebot

Consider Woebot, an AI-driven chatbot designed to assist with mild to moderate emotional challenges. Users can talk to Woebot about stress, sadness, and other bottled-up feelings. Many find its timely, comforting responses effective in alleviating emotional burdens.

This example underscores the real-world potential of emotion AI when applied thoughtfully and ethically. It’s a glimpse into how technology can make emotional support more accessible.
